    Customer service in store was amazing. My problem began with trying to get my purchase delivered. I was promised my order would be delivered on Dec. 22 fully assembled. I received all my texts and responded to each of them as requested. On Sunday Dec 21st, I received a text with confirming my delivery window and then Monday morning they sent a text rescheduling the entire delivery. When calling them to find out what was going on I was told there was "no room on the truck." While super inconvenient for me, I agreed to move it to the 24th because I would still get it in time for Christmas, as it was a gift. Now, it is the 24th and I receive a phone call from the Assistant Manager of the Rojas store, telling me they can either deliver my purchase in a box today or I can wait to get it delivered another day fully assembled. I asked what was going on because this is the second time they do this to me. She replied that they only received my purchase in their warehouse yesterday and were not able to assemble it. I asked her how that was my problem. On Monday, I was told the delivery "did not fit' on the truck. She said, I am only filling the order, if the westside store "over promised and under delivered" that is nothing I have control over. So basically, it isn't her problem. I had no choice but to accept my delivery in the box or my husband would have no gift. I feel like this is horrible service on Lowe's part from both locations. I gave them the benefit of the doubt when we had the same situation a few months ago, when we purchased our appliances from them but now I see this is just how they operate.
